You can't tell. The area doesn't tell you the dimensions. There are an infinite number of different shapes with different dimensions and different perimeters that all have the same area. -- If the 575 square units of area are in the shape of a circle, then the radius of the circle is 13.53 units and the perimeter (circumference) is 85 units. (rounded) -- If the 575 square units of area are in the shape of a square, then each side of the square is 23.98 units and the perimeter is 95.92 units. (rounded) -- The 575 square units of area could also be a (23 x 25) rectangle, with perimeter of 96. -- The 575 square units of area could also be a (115 x 5) rectangle, with perimeter of 240. -- The 575 square units of area could also be a (575 x 1) rectangle, with perimeter of 1,152.

No, rectangles with the same area do not necessarily have the same perimeter. The perimeter of a rectangle depends on both its length and width, while the area is simply the product of these two dimensions. For instance, a rectangle measuring 2 units by 6 units has an area of 12 square units and a perimeter of 16 units, while a rectangle measuring 3 units by 4 units also has an area of 12 square units but a perimeter of 14 units. Thus, different length and width combinations can yield the same area but different perimeters.
